EFFECTIVENESS OF GYPSUM APPLICATION AND PLOWING IN IMPROVING SEVERELY DETERIORATED CLAY SOIL CHARCTERISTICS AND WHEAT GROWTH AT QAROUN LAKE SHORE LINE, FAYOUM GOVERNORATE

Abstract

Wide areas of severely deteriorated lands at Quaroun Lake
shoreline have been left bare since a long time , although many attempts
were made to cultivate some parts but all failed. A field experiment was
carried out in a private field during the season 2014-2015 at the north of
Fayoum Governorate (about 200 m from Quaroun Lake, Sinours
District).Nine treatments were tested including the control, shallow and
deep plowing ( 20 and 60 cm ), application of 50% and 100 % of
estimated gypsum requirements and their combinations. Remarkable
decreases were found in the values of soil bulk density, ECe values,
soluble cations and anions, soil paste pH and removal sodium efficiency (
RSE). Values of total porosity, hydraulic conductivity, field capacity,
permanent wilting point, available water increased with soil deep plowing
and gypsum application. Also, grain and straw yields of grown wheat crop < br />were enhanced with soil deep plowing together with gypsum application
and leaching with required amounts of water in comparison with those of
the control treatment . Deep plowing with the application of 100 % of
estimated gypsum requirements resulted in the best improvement of both
soil characteristics and plant growth among all other treatments. Results
of the present experiment that was conducted in a private farm has
actually encouraged farmers of the studied area to start land reclamation
and cultivation of their lands that were left bare since a long time.
